    Default Venting warm air to cold outside

    Hi all

    I'm trying to overcome heat problems in a closet,and I was planning to run the exhaust fan through the outside wall straight to outside. I'm just thinking that the winters here can get really cold, like even -22F, so will the outcoming warm air show up as vapor at that point? Thanks.

    Whether or not the vented air would show as vapour would depend on humidity content, but if everywhere is snowy and you have one spot on your house where snow is melting, it might draw the wrong kind of attention.

    Can you hook that to, say, a bathroom exhaust vent?
